The Physics of Texture: Why "Flat" Solids Fail in Appliqué

Kelly opens a Valentine bundle and highlights textured solids (tone-on-tone) over flat solids. This isn't just aesthetic; it’s optical physics.

The "Dead Zone" Effect: When you surround a perfectly flat, solid-colored piece of fabric with a raised, shiny satin stitch, the fabric in the center often looks sunken or "dead" because it reflects light differently than the thread.

The Fix: Tone-on-tone prints (like tiny dots or swirls) break up the light reflection. They create visual volume that stands up to the heavy border.

Beginner Selection Rules:

  1. The 6-Foot Rule: Put the fabric on a table and step back 6 feet. If you can clearly read the color (e.g., "That is definitely Pink"), it works. If it blurs into grey/mud, it will fail on the shirt.
  2. Avoid Micro-Contrast: High-contrast tiny prints (like black stars on white) create "visual vibration" that fights your embroidery design.

Warning: Tool Safety
Never, under any circumstances, use your fabric shears on paper, stabilizer, or Heat n Bond.
Sensory Check: When cutting fabric, you should hear a crisp shhh-snip sound. If you hear a crunch* or the fabric folds over the blade, your scissors are dull. Dull scissors result in jagged appliqué edges, which leads to "pokies" (fabric tufts poking through the satin stitch).

Handling Specialty Substrates: The "Contamination" Danger

Specialty materials—Reversible Sequin ("Flippy") fabric, Vinyl, and Seersucker—are not just "other colors." They are contaminants and fragile assets.

1. Sequin Containment

Sequins are micro-blades. When cut, they shed plastic shards and dust.

  • Risk: If stored in open drawers, sequin dust migrates into standard fabrics and eventually into your machine's bobbin case.
  • Symptoms: You will hear a grinding noise or see skipped stitches.
  • Protocol: Sealed Ziplock bags. Always.

2. Vinyl Preservation

  • Risk: Vinyl has "memory." If you fold it or jam it into a drawer, that crease is permanent.
  • Protocol: Store flat or rolled loosely.

3. The Need for Speed Control

When stitching these materials:

  • Standard Speed: 800-1000 stitches per minute (SPM).
  • Specialty Sweet Spot: Slow down to 500-600 SPM.
  • Sensory Anchor: You want to hear a rhythmic thump-thump-thump, not a frantic buzz-whirrr. High speed on vinyl generates friction heat, which can melt the material onto your needle.

The "Pre-Fused" Scrap Bin: Turning Trash into Inventory

Kelly saves scraps that are "big enough to hold stitches"—specifically those already fused with Heat n Bond Lite.

The Economics of Scraps: In production, Time > Materials. Applying fusible backing (ironing) takes 3–5 minutes per session (setup, heat up, fuse, cool). If you save a pre-fused scrap, you have saved 5 minutes of labor. That scrap is now free money.

The "Harvest" Rule: Do not become a hoarder.

  • Keep one bin.
  • When it is full: Dump it out. Keep the usable primary colors (Black, White, Red). Throw away the confetti. If you have to fight to find a piece, the bin is too full.

Setup & Decision Logic: Matching Substrate to Stabilizer

The Setup phase defines the structural integrity of your embroidery. Mismatching here causes the dreaded "puckering" (where fabric wrinkles around the design).

The Golden Rule of Stability:

  • Stabilizer must support the fabric + the stitch count.
  • Hooping must be "drum tight" (Sensory check: Tap the hooped stabilizer; it should sound like a drum).

Decision Tree: Fabric Type → Methodology

1. Is the base fabric stretchy (T-shirt, Knit)?

  • Yes: MUST use Cutaway Stabilizer. (Tearaway will result in the design falling out or shifting).
  • No: Go to step 2.

2. Is the fabric textured or unstable (Seersucker, Waffle weave)?

  • Yes: Use a heavier Cutaway or Fusible Poly-mesh to prevent shifting. Consider floating if hooping distorts the texture.
  • No (Standard Cotton): Tearaway is fast and acceptable for light designs, but Cutaway is safer for dense appliqué.

3. Is "Hoop Burn" (shiny ring marks) a risk?

  • Yes (Velvet, Performance Wear, Delicate Cotton): Do not use standard tightening hoops.

Warning: Magnet Safety
Magnetic Hoops involve powerful neodymium magnets.
* Pinch Hazard: Keep fingers clear of the "snap zone." The closing force can cause blood blister or bruising.
* Medical Devices: Keep at least 6 inches away from Pacemakers or ICDs.
* Storage: Store with the provided spacers. Do not let two top frames snap together without a barrier; separating them is extremely difficult.

FAQ

  • Q: How do I know embroidery hooping tension is correct for appliqué stabilizer setup on a home embroidery machine?
    A: Aim for “drum tight” stabilizer with fabric held taut but not stretched or distorted.
    • Tap the hooped stabilizer to confirm firmness before stitching.
    • Align fabric grainline and stop tightening if the grainline bends or the fabric looks pulled.
    • Match stabilizer to the fabric first (stretchy fabrics require cutaway).
    • Success check: The hooped area makes a drum-like sound when tapped and the fabric surface looks flat with no ripples.
    • If it still fails: Move up to a heavier cutaway/fusible poly-mesh or float the fabric if hooping distorts texture.
  • Q: What stabilizer should I use to prevent puckering around appliqué on knit T-shirts versus woven cotton?
    A: Use cutaway stabilizer for any stretchy knit, and use tearaway only for stable wovens with light designs (cutaway is safer for dense appliqué).
    • Identify stretch by pulling the fabric gently; if it stretches, choose cutaway.
    • Choose heavier cutaway or fusible poly-mesh for unstable textures (seersucker/waffle) to reduce shifting.
    • Avoid stretching the fabric after hooping; let the hoop hold it, not your hands.
    • Success check: After stitching, the fabric around the design lies flat without wrinkling or pulling inward.
    • If it still fails: Re-check hooping (over-stretched fabric in the hoop is a common cause) and increase stabilizer support.

  • Q: How do I fix grinding noise and skipped stitches caused by lint or sequin dust in the bobbin case on an embroidery machine?
    A: Clean the bobbin area immediately—sequin dust and lint can cause grinding sounds and skipped stitches.
    • Stop the machine and remove the needle plate as the first step.
    • Brush out lint and debris from the bobbin case area before restarting.
    • Store reversible sequin fabric sealed in Ziplock bags to prevent dust migrating into regular fabrics and the machine.
    • Success check: The machine sound returns to normal and stitches form consistently without skips.
    • If it still fails: Arrange professional servicing because debris may be deeper than routine cleaning can reach.
  • Q: What is the safe stitching speed for reversible sequin fabric and vinyl on an embroidery machine to avoid melting or needle heat issues?
    A: Slow down to about 500–600 SPM for specialty substrates instead of running the typical 800–1000 SPM range.
    • Reduce machine speed before starting the design on vinyl or sequins.
    • Listen for a steady, rhythmic “thump-thump-thump,” not a frantic high-speed buzz.
    • Keep specialty materials contained (sequins sealed; vinyl stored flat/rolled) to protect both material and machine.
    • Success check: The material stays intact (no melting/drag) and the stitching remains even without distortion.
    • If it still fails: Pause and reassess friction/heat buildup—slowing further and rechecking needle condition is a safe next step (follow the machine manual).
  • Q: When should I replace embroidery needles, and how can I do a quick needle sharpness check before an appliqué run?
    A: Replace needles about every 8 hours of run time or after a major project, and swap immediately if the needle fails a quick snag test.
    • Track approximate run time and change needles on a routine schedule.
    • Drag the needle tip gently backward across a scrap of nylon to test for snagging.
    • Keep new needles in your “Phase 0” prep area so you don’t start a job with a questionable needle.
    • Success check: The needle glides over nylon without snagging and stitching runs without unusual thread breaks.
    • If it still fails: Inspect the bobbin area for lint/sequin dust and confirm stabilizer/hooping are correct before continuing.
